Nestled in the Swiss Alps, Disentis Sedrun is known for its stunning landscapes and extensive ski terrain. The resort boasts over 120 kilometers of slopes, catering to both beginners and advanced skiers.

The ski area of Disentis Sedrun is in the Swiss Alps at an altitude of 1,150m, with 168km of marked runs.

Disentis Sedrun is part of the SkiArena Andermatt-Sedrun area with access to 120km of downhill skiing, with 65 marked pistes, served by a total of 22 ski lifts. In addition to the skiing in Disentis Sedrun itself (168km of pisted ski runs), the appropriate ski Lift Pass will allow you to ski or snowboard in the other SkiArena Andermatt-Sedrun ski resorts of Andermatt and Realp.

Disentis Sedrun comprises the villages of Disentis and Sedrun.

 Notable Ski Runs

The longest possible descent in Disentis Sedrun is 12km long.

The Disentis Sedrun ski area features the impressive peaks of the Oberalp and the surrounding mountains, reaching elevations of up to 2,800 meters. Notable pistes include the long red runs on the Oberalp and the challenging black runs from the Disentis area, with key lifts like the Oberalp cable car and the Disentis gondola providing access to the slopes.

Disentis Sedrun offers good sking, particularly, for Intermediate and Beginner skiers.

Snowboarding

Snowboarders will appreciate the terrain parks at Disentis Sedrun, particularly the fun park on the Oberalp, which features various jumps and obstacles. The diverse terrain also offers ample opportunities for off-piste adventures.

Where is Disentis Sedrun?

This ski resort is in the Swiss Alps in Surselva, Graubünden.

How to get there

 By Air

The nearest airport to Disentis Sedrun is St. Gallen-Altenrhein, 122 minutes drive away.

Basel, Friedrichshafen, Sion, Berne, Lugano, Basel-Mulhouse-Freiburg, Zurich and Memmingen airports are all within three hours drive.

Disentis Sedrun is easily accessible by car or public transport. The nearest major airports are in Zurich and Lugano, with train connections to Disentis providing a scenic journey through the Alps.

Infrastructure

Ski Lift Capacity

The 10 ski lifts are able to uplift 12,600 skiers and snowboarders every hour.

Aprés Ski

After a day on the slopes, unwind at the popular Caffè Bar Piz Ault or enjoy a lively atmosphere at the Après-Ski Bar in Sedrun. For dining, the local restaurants serve Swiss cuisine, providing a cozy end to your ski day.
